As from tomorrow (4th November) women in Ireland & the UK will be working until the new year, for free. It’s simple enough to understand. Whilst the average working male has earned his weekly wage or monthly salary, his female counterpart has earned around 13.5%-17% less, depending on how you juggle the figures.
But juggle them all you will, she’s working from around November 4th until December 31st for free. No wonder there’s been an increase in the number of working women since 1973, they’re just cheaper. And this doesn’t even begin to address the problems of equal pay for work of equal value. Why does a male caretaker earn more than a female care assistant? Why are most caretakers men and care assistants women? Is it because he has greater responsibility; are buildings more important than children?
